Here's a little New Year's cocktail for you, one of the rare opportunities to watch my dear friend Tommy Emmanuel playing the rhythm and blues classic "One Mint Julep". You won't find this too often on KZbin. Taken from his performance at the 3rd annual Tommy Emmanuel Guitar Festival in Rietberg/Germany, August 2006, I had the pleasure to be invited to with the Hot Club of Nashville.
